Thames Valley Police said today: ‘The collision happened on the M40 at Beaconsfield at around 5.53pm on Monday January 31. Three vehicles were involved in a collision on the southbound M40 between Junction 2 and Junction 1A.
“The incident involved a black Harley Davidson motorbike, a black Mitsubishi and a red Peugeot. Sadly the driver of the motorbike, a man in his 40s from Hertfordshire, died.
“His next of kin have been notified and are being supported by specially trained officers.”
The M40 Southbound was closed for several hours for survey work but has since reopened.
